§ 443.134 — Exception for photogrammetry and construction surveying.

Text
443.134 Nothing in this chapter may be construed to prohibit a person who has not been granted a license to engage in the practice of professional land surveying under this chapter from utilizing photogrammetry or remote sensing techniques or performing topographic surveying, construction surveying, or geodetic surveying for purposes other than a boundary establishment or reestablishment specified in s. 443.01 (6s) .

Legislative History
443.134 History History: 1979 c. 167 ; 1981 c. 334 s. 25 (1) ; 2011 a. 146 ; 2013 a. 358 .
